Narrative:
Crashed performing aerobatics prior to landing at RAF Castle Camps, Cambridgeshire. 22/07/1940
Pilot:
P/O (36266) John Laurence Bickerdike, RAF ( from New Zealand ) : killed.
R.I.P.

John Bickerdike is buried at All Saints' Churchyard, Wimbish.
